#6A5FAB Accessibility & WCAG Contrast

Relative luminance of #6A5FAB is 0.1419. Its WCAG contrast ratio is 5.47:1 against white and 3.84:1 against black. Use the card with the higher ratio for body text.

#6A5FAB — Frequently Asked Questions

What is the hex code for #6A5FAB?+
The hex code for #6A5FAB is #6A5FAB. In RGB it's rgb(106, 95, 171), and in HSL it's hsl(249, 31%, 52%).
What is the RGB value of #6A5FAB?+
#6A5FAB in RGB is (106, 95, 171). Written in CSS: rgb(106, 95, 171).
What is the CMYK value of #6A5FAB?+
#6A5FAB converts to CMYK(38%, 44%, 0%, 33%) for print. Hex equivalent is #6A5FAB.
Is #6a5fab a warm or cool color?+
#6A5FAB (#6A5FAB) is a cool purple — its hue sits at 249° on the color wheel, placing it in the cool part of the spectrum.
What color family does #6a5fab belong to?+
#6A5FAB belongs to the purple family. Its HSL is 249°, 31%, 52% — a cool tone within the broader purple group.
Is #6a5fab accessible for body text on a white background?+
#6A5FAB on white reaches a WCAG contrast ratio of 5.47:1 — passes WCAG AA for body text on white.
What is the closest Pantone match for #6a5fab?+
The nearest Pantone match for #6A5FAB (#6A5FAB) is 17-3938 Very Peri, calculated by Euclidean RGB distance over the Pantone Matching System.

How to use #6A5FAB in design

Practical guidance for using #6a5fab (#6A5FAB) across four design contexts, derived from its hue, lightness, saturation, and WCAG contrast.

Web & UI design

Use #6A5FAB (#6A5FAB) as primary text or icon color on white backgrounds — at 5.5:1 contrast it passes WCAG AA for body copy. Avoid placing #6a5fab text on dark surfaces; the contrast drops below the AA threshold.

Branding & identity

As a brand color, #6A5FAB (#6A5FAB) reads as balanced and approachable and versatile across product tiers. It fits naturally into luxury, beauty, creative, premium subscription products. Pair it with a higher-contrast accent (warm if purple runs cool, cool if it runs warm) for visual hierarchy. Test legibility on both your logo and small UI text before locking it in — saturation that works on a 200px logo can feel overpowering at favicon scale.

Fashion & apparel

#6A5FAB flatters cool-leaning skin tones (pink, rosy, blue undertones) and works best in autumn/winter collections. Pair it with cool neutrals (charcoal, slate, off-white, black) and it works as a sophisticated alternative to navy. Deep cool tones photograph richly under indoor light and read as quiet luxury — strong choice for eveningwear.

Interior design

#6A5FAB works as either a primary wall color or a strong accent — versatile across most rooms. As a wall color it pairs with white trim and warm wood; as an accent (sofa, chair, large art) it lifts a neutral room without overwhelming it. Test a large swatch against your room's natural light at three times of day before committing — mid-tone colors shift more than light or dark colors do.
